I own a 1988 asc Mclaren mustang that i restored. I am a little confused with Henry from asc when ever i order parts i always have a problem, there is always a problem with items missing or he forgot to pack something .I ordered a set of front rail seals i open the box they are used i call him back to find out why he would send old ones when i ordered new ones no good answer he just says send them back no apology and i also pay for shipping He sends one only I him call back wheres the other oh ok i will send it out 2 months still waiting i call him back he says ok i will send it out still waiting is there anyone else out there besides me

I ordered a set of taillight covers one came cracked he sent a replacement right away. I ordered a stripe kit. The 360 degree stripe was short by 3". When I told him he sent me a whole roll of tape.

I have found that if you want to order parts its best to call him and be very specific with what you want.

I too have purchased several (make that many) parts from Henry over the past few years. I have also met him at car shows and have had some nice conversations. I have had no real problems with the purchases. As with any old, rare cars like ours, parts can be tough. Especially since ours were basically hand made and "no two are alike" seems to run true. So be patient and yes, give him a call so you are both clear what you need.

Henry may not be perfect, but I am happy that at least someone has continued to be a source for these great cars. Don't know where I would be with the restoration without his help.
